Step-by-Step Instructions

1. Gather the Ingredients: To make these No-Bake Chocolate Peanut Butter Rice Crispy Treats, you’ll need rice crispy cereal, creamy peanut butter, chocolate chips, and some sweetener like marshmallows or honey.

2. Melt the Peanut Butter: In a saucepan over low heat, melt the peanut butter until it’s warm and runny. If you want extra sweetness, you can add marshmallows or syrup at this stage.

3. Combine with Chocolate: Once the peanut butter is melted, mix in the chocolate chips until they’re fully melted and integrated into a creamy mixture.

4. Mix with Cereal: In a large bowl, combine the melted peanut butter and chocolate blend with the rice crispy cereal. Stir gently until all the cereal is coated evenly.

5. Press into a Pan: Transfer the mixture to a greased baking dish and press it down firmly to create an even layer of your No-Bake Chocolate Peanut Butter Rice Crispy Treats.

6. Chill and Set: Refrigerate the pan for about 30-60 minutes, allowing the treat to set and firm up.

7. Cut and Serve: Once set, remove from the fridge, cut into squares, and enjoy!

Tips

Use Parchment Paper: Lining your dish with parchment paper can make it easier to lift out the treats once they’re set, helping you cut perfect squares.
For Extra Crunch: Consider adding chopped nuts or chocolate chunks for added texture and flavor in your No-Bake Chocolate Peanut Butter Rice Crispy Treats.
Watch the Heat: Ensure you melt the peanut butter slowly on low heat to prevent burning.

Alternative Methods

If you’re looking to customize your treats, here are a few alternative methods to consider:

Vegan Version: Substitute creamy almond or cashew butter for peanut butter and use dairy-free chocolate chips for a vegan-friendly option.
Flavor Variations: Add a sprinkle of sea salt on top or incorporate other flavors like vanilla or coconut for a unique twist on your No-Bake Chocolate Peanut Butter Rice Crispy Treats.
Healthy Swaps: Use brown rice cereal for a healthier take or add dried fruit for added nutrition.
